Subject: [PATCH 1/2] ath9k: use standard max(), remove A_MAX macro
Date: Wed, 15 Jun 2011 18:01:05 -0400 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20110615220105.1755.45521.stgit@mj.roinet.com> (raw)
Signed-off-by: Pavel Roskin <proski@gnu.org>
---
dr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/ath9k.h | 2 --
dr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/rc.c | 6 +++---
2 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/ath9k.h b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/ath9k.h
index 3bf1d83..b9c177f 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/ath9k.h
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/ath9k.h
@@ -54,8 +54,6 @@ struct ath_node;
(_l) &= ((_sz) - 1); \
} while (0)
-#define A_MAX(a, b) ((a) > (b) ? (a) : (b))
-
#define TSF_TO_TU(_h,_l) \
((((u32)(_h)) << 22) | (((u32)(_l)) >> 10))
di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/rc.c b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/rc.c
index ba7f36a..e7fe4d9 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/rc.c
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ath9k/rc.c
@@ -533,7 +533,7 @@ static u8 ath_rc_setvalid_rates(struct ath_rate_priv *ath_rc_priv,
[valid_rate_count] = j;
ath_rc_priv->valid_phy_ratecnt[phy] += 1;
ath_rc_set_valid_rate_idx(ath_rc_priv, j, 1);
- hi = A_MAX(hi, j);
+ hi = max(hi, j);
}
}
}
@@ -569,7 +569,7 @@ static u8 ath_rc_setvalid_htrates(struct ath_rate_priv *ath_rc_priv,
[ath_rc_priv->valid_phy_ratecnt[phy]] = j;
ath_rc_priv->valid_phy_ratecnt[phy] += 1;
ath_rc_set_valid_rate_idx(ath_rc_priv, j, 1);
- hi = A_MAX(hi, j);
+ hi = max(hi, j);
}
}
@@ -1228,7 +1228,7 @@ static void ath_rc_init(struct ath_softc *sc,
ht_mcs,
ath_rc_priv->ht_cap);
}
- hi = A_MAX(hi, hthi);
+ hi = max(hi, hthi);
}
ath_rc_priv->rate_table_size = hi + 1;
